Step 7 of the Quillpress key ceremony: after the spooler microservice keys are sealed, each new team member must verify the escrow envelope against the witness log before signing. Once both witnesses at Marrowgate have countersigned, read back the escrow passphrase aloud for confirmation; it is recorded immediately below this item.

vault phrase of tafof-tadug = holix-ulaox

Subject: Shuttle-bus gate access

Contractors: the shuttle from Gate 3 at the Eastbrook campus runs every 20 minutes, 07:00–19:00. Hi-vis required beyond the gate. Sign in at the kiosk before boarding. No tools on the shuttle without a carry permit. The gate turnstile is keypad-operated; enter the pass code below when prompted.

turnstile pass: bdg-PD-2

Alert: TumbleBox locker-access failures above threshold. This fires when more than 5% of unlock attempts in the laundry-locker flow fail within a 10-minute window — usually the door-controller gateway timing out, occasionally a stale access token after the nightly rotation. Customers get stuck at the locker, so treat it as urgent during evening peak. Triage steps and the gateway restart procedure are on the internal page below.

wiki page, fajof-tajef: https://vault.tolvaqio.corp/board/pipeline/pages/ticket/c20d7f984bcc9e12

# ORM Refactor — Limits & Quotas

The Marlowe ORM shim caps connections and query time during the Drayfen migration. Limits are deliberately tighter than production defaults to surface slow paths early. Raising them requires sign-off from the data platform rotation. Do not bypass via raw cursors. The enforced constants are as follows.

tuning constants:
QUOTAS = {
    "oliix": 5,
    "quenix": 2,
}

Warranty spend on the Veltrax HD-series exceeded plan by 38%. Root cause: seal failures in units shipped from the Korvalle plant between March and June. Reserve adequacy is now in question; current accrual covers roughly 60% of projected claims. Rework costs are trending above initial estimates. Supplier recovery talks with Dainmoor Components are underway but slow. Recommend increasing the reserve this quarter and holding further HD-series promotions. Strategic implications are summarised in the note below.

board note of taweg-fahof: Eliiusax Group plans to raise the Ralwyn list price by 60 percent in August.